Re: Retirement of the Stonebriar product line

Stonebriar sales have declined for five consecutive quarters and support costs now exceed contribution margin. The retirement plan is staged: new orders close end of Q2, existing contracts honoured through their terms, and spares stocked for twenty-four months. Sales leads should steer prospects toward the Ashgrove range; migration incentives are already approved. Customer comms are drafted and awaiting legal sign-off. The forward strategy behind this decision is set out in the note below.

confidential, yafog-hagug: Gross margin on Druix came in at 10 percent against a plan of 15 percent. Only 5 of the 80 pilot accounts renewed Druix, so a churn review is set for October 1.

## Gateway Rate Limiting

Welcome aboard! When reviewing changes to the Ferngate internal gateway, keep an eye on the rate limit config — it's token-bucket per caller, and people love to "temporarily" bump their quota in the same PR as a feature. Don't let that slide. Limits live in `limits.yaml`, defaults in `base.yaml`, and anything over 500 rps needs a comment explaining why. Config bundles are signed at merge time, so reviewers should verify them against the key that appears just below.

signing key of yajog-kafof = bky19_orbYRY3Abj3KpZesMie

# Guest Wi-Fi Desk — Reception, Fennelgate Plaza

Quick guide for anyone covering the front desk. Visitors asking about internet access should be sent to the guest Wi-Fi desk, the small counter to the left of the main reception at Corvana Labs. Hand them a visitor slip, point them to the signage, and remind them the network resets nightly at midnight. If the desk tablet is locked when you arrive for your shift, unlock it using the reception badge code noted below.

turnstile pass: bdg-QZV-3

TURN-208: Gatevale turnstile counters at the Merrow Field pilot double-count when a rotation reverses mid-cycle. Attendance totals drift roughly 2% high per event. The debounce window fix is implemented, reviewed by Ilsa, and soak-tested across two simulated match days without drift. Ready for your cut; the candidate build is identified below.

trace token, tagag-tafog: htk6_5ed18c